Store

DFRobot

· MPN: SEN0667

$14.08 |
In stock at supplier
No reviews yet

This compact Fermion module is built around Bosch Sensortec’s BMP581 high-performance barometric pressure sensor chip. It measures pressure and temperature w...

Estimated Delivery
Arrives
Disclaimer
View Markdown
Secure checkout

This compact Fermion module is built around Bosch Sensortec’s BMP581 high-performance barometric pressure sensor chip. It measures pressure and temperature with high precision, offering ±0.3 hPa typical absolute pressure accuracy for detecting small altitude, floor-level or liquid-level changes.

The module supports I2C, I3C and SPI, making it suitable for a wide range of microcontrollers and embedded systems. Its 2.54 mm pin header socket helps with breadboarding and integration into finished PCBs, while the onboard BMP581 features digital filtering and a hardware FIFO buffer for smoother data output.

With low operating current and a 2 μA sleep current, it is well suited to battery-powered IoT nodes, wearables and compact sensing projects. The product wiki provides a connection diagram, library, schematic, dimensions and component layout diagram, CAD files and the BMP581 chip datasheet.

The package includes the Fermion: BMP581 High-Precision Barometric Pressure & Temperature Sensor ×1 and a 10pin-2.54 Black Single Row Pin Header ×1.

Specifications:

  • Operating Voltage: DC 3.3V
  • Operating Current: 200μA
  • Sleep Current: 2μA
  • Communication Interface: I2C / I3C /SPI
  • Interface Form: 2.54mm Pin Header Socket
  • I2C Address: 0x47 (Default) / 0x46
  • Pressure Measurement Range: 30 ~ 125 kPa
  • Temperature Measurement Range: 0 ~ 65 °C
  • Absolute Pressure Accuracy: ±0.3 hPa (Typ.)
  • Relative Pressure Accuracy: ±0.06 hPa / 10 kPa (Typ.)
  • Relative Altitude Accuracy: ±0.5 m / 10 kPa
  • Temperature Drift Coefficient: ±0.5 Pa / K
  • Pressure Data Resolution: 1 / 64
  • Ultra-Low Noise: < 0.1 Pa (RMS, without low-pass filter enabled)
  • PCB Dimensions: 19×16×2.49 mm
  • Mounting Hole Spacing: 14 mm
  • Mounting Hole Diameter: 2.0 mm
  • Logic note: This module operates at 3.3V logic. A logic level converter is required when using with 5V microcontrollers (e.g., Arduino Uno).

Ideal applications include drone stability hovering and vertical velocity control, GPS navigation enhancement, indoor navigation and floor localisation, fitness tracking, precision weather stations and hydrological monitoring.

Jargon buster

Plain-language definitions for the technical terms used above.

FIFO
FIFO stands for “first in, first out” and is a small memory buffer inside the sensor that stores recent readings in order. This matters because it can help capture motion data without the microcontroller needing to read the sensor every single instant.
GPS
The US satellite navigation system used by GNSS receivers to calculate position and time. Support for GPS is important because it is widely available and often used together with other constellations for more reliable positioning.
I2C
I2C is a two-wire communication bus used by many sensors and small modules. It matters because several I2C devices can share the same two wires, but each device needs a compatible address and your controller must support I2C.
I2C address
An I2C address is the number a device uses so a microcontroller can tell it apart from other devices on the same I2C bus. It matters because two devices with the same fixed address may conflict if used together.
I3C
I3C is a newer two-wire communication bus designed as a faster, more capable successor to I2C for sensors and small peripherals. It matters because I3C devices may offer better speed and features, but they need compatible hardware and software support.
IoT
Short for Internet of Things, meaning physical devices that connect to networks or the internet to send data or be controlled remotely. It matters if you want projects such as connected sensors, remote controls or classroom data-logging activities.
PCB
A printed circuit board is a rigid board with copper tracks that connect electronic parts without loose wires. For this kit, the PCBs also form the airplane shape, so they are both the circuit base and part of the finished model.
RMS
RMS is a way of describing the effective level of an AC signal, such as an audio output voltage. It helps compare audio output levels more meaningfully than a peak voltage number.
SPI
A fast serial communication bus often used for displays, memory cards, and sensors. It matters because SPI devices need specific pins for clock and data, plus a separate chip-select line for each device.

Supplier page — dfrobot.com

Supplier Description · 138.2 KB · Click any page to view full size

Download PDF
Stella
Stella Expert

Ask me anything about this product

Maddy, co-founder of Little Bird

Need help? We're here for you!

Hi, I'm Maddy. My team and I are ready to help with your order or any questions.